**H Mart to Open First Fort Worth-Area Location in Haltom City**

H Mart, the well-known Asian supermarket chain, is set to open its first location in the Fort Worth area and third in the Dallas-Fort Worth metro. The company plans to build a 43,000-square-foot store in a large shopping center at an estimated cost of $9 million.

Located in Haltom City, about 10 miles north of downtown Fort Worth, the new store will be situated at North Beach Street and Northeast Loop 820. It will serve as the anchor tenant for a retail center featuring more than 50 stores, including restaurants, bakeries, coffee and tea shops, and salons. Construction is expected to be completed by December, with FTC Architects overseeing the design.

According to reports, the shopping center is already approximately 85-90% leased.

This development is part of a larger project involving a partnership between Haltom City, Mercantile Partners LP, KBC Advisors, Velocis, and Haltom City Forest Properties LLC. In addition to the H Mart store, the project includes a $42 million, four-building industrial park. Haltom City is supporting the initiative through Chapter 380 incentives.
